How Much Does Flooring Installation Cost in Homestead, FL?

Flooring pricing depends mostly on material choice and what's underneath the old floor. This guide breaks down real cost ranges by material and by project size, based on the jobs we run around Homestead. Looking for tile specifically? See our tile installation cost guide instead.

Typical Cost Range

Most Homestead-area flooring projects

$2,000 to $8,000

A single room lands at the lower end. A full-home install with old-floor removal runs toward the higher end. The ranges below break down why.

Cost by Material

Material is the biggest lever on price, installed.

Luxury vinyl tile (LVT)$2 to $5 per sq ft
Luxury vinyl plank (LVP)$4.50 to $12 per sq ft
Laminate$3 to $8 per sq ft
Engineered hardwood$6 to $14 per sq ft

Cost by Project Size

Single room (under 300 sq ft)$1,300 to $3,600
Multiple rooms (300 to 800 sq ft)$3,000 to $9,600
Whole home (1,200+ sq ft)$5,400 to $14,400+

Old Floor Removal & Subfloor Prep

Removing old flooring, whether it's carpet, old tile, or worn vinyl, along with leveling or repairing the subfloor underneath and adding transition strips between rooms, typically adds $150 to $700 to a project. The exact number depends on what's coming out and what condition the subfloor is in once it's exposed, which we check before finalizing a quote.

Why Vinyl Plank Fits South Florida Homes

Luxury vinyl plank is fully water resistant, which matters in a climate with as much ambient humidity as South Florida, and it holds up better than laminate or solid hardwood in rooms near an exterior door or a kitchen. That's part of why it's become the most requested flooring material in the jobs we run in Homestead and the surrounding cities.

Permits & Timeline

Flooring installation is cosmetic work and doesn't require a Miami-Dade County permit. A single room typically takes 1 to 2 days. A whole-home installation of 1,200 to 2,000 square feet usually runs 3 to 6 days, longer if old flooring removal or subfloor repair comes first.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does flooring installation cost in Homestead, FL?

Most flooring jobs we run fall between $2,000 and $8,000 for a typical room-sized to whole-home project, depending on material and square footage. Luxury vinyl plank, the most common choice we install, typically runs $4.50 to $12 per square foot installed.

What's the cost difference between vinyl plank, vinyl tile, and laminate?

Luxury vinyl plank (LVP) runs $4.50 to $12 per square foot installed and is the most popular choice for its water resistance and wood-look finish. Luxury vinyl tile (LVT) typically runs $2 to $5 per square foot. Both cost less than solid hardwood while holding up better to South Florida humidity.

Does removing old flooring add to the cost?

Yes. Removing old flooring, repairing or leveling the subfloor underneath, and installing transition strips between rooms typically adds $150 to $700 to a project, depending on what's being removed and the subfloor's condition once it's exposed.

Do I need a permit for flooring installation in Miami-Dade County?

No. Flooring installation is cosmetic work and doesn't require a permit in Miami-Dade County, whether it's vinyl plank, laminate, or another floating or glue-down material.

How long does flooring installation take?

A single room typically takes 1 to 2 days. A whole-home installation of 1,200 to 2,000 square feet usually runs 3 to 6 days, longer if old flooring removal or subfloor repair is needed first.

Is vinyl plank a good choice for a humid South Florida home?

Generally, yes. Luxury vinyl plank is fully water resistant and handles humidity better than laminate or solid hardwood, which is part of why it's become the most requested flooring material in the jobs we run here.
